Transaction b43cb75f778ec7906318c680ca550230839baf8485a33ba769b36f1dcb867635
2 Input
2 Outputs
- b43cb75f778ec7906318c680ca550230839baf8485a33ba769b36f1dcb867635:0
- b43cb75f778ec7906318c680ca550230839baf8485a33ba769b36f1dcb867635:1
value 708491
address 1PPDx4yXThQBa2gGBD8dM26U3K3SNjzEh1
value 1094020
address 1AZgQZWYRteh6UyF87hwuvyWj73NvWKpL